Nissan Juke Service and Repair Manual : P1220 fuel pump control module (FPCM)
DTC Logic
DTC DETECTION LOGIC
DTC CONFIRMATION PROCEDURE
1.PRECONDITIONING
1. Turn ignition switch OFF and wait at least 10 seconds.
2. Turn ignition switch ON.
3. Turn ignition switch OFF and wait at least 10 seconds.
TESTING CONDITION:
• Before performing the following procedure, confirm that battery voltage is
between 12 - 15 V at idle.
• Before performing the following procedure, check that the engine coolant temperature is −10°C (14°F) or more.
>> GO TO 2.
2.PERFORM DTC CONFIRMATION PROCEDURE
1. Start engine and let it idle for at least 5 seconds.
If engine does not start, crank engine for at least 5 seconds.
2. Check DTC.
Is DTC detected? YES >> Proceed to EC-323, "Diagnosis Procedure".
NO >> INSPECTION END
Diagnosis Procedure
1.CHECK FPCM POWER SUPPLY
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ect FPCM harness connector.
3. Turn ignition switch ON.
4. Check the voltage between FPCM harness connector and ground.
Is the inspection result normal? YES >> GO TO 2.
NO >> GO TO 3.
2.CHECK FPCM PO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ect IPDM E/R harness connector.
3. Check the continuity between FPCM harness connector and IPDM E/R harness connector.
4. Also check harness for short to ground.
Is the inspection result normal? YES >> Perform the trouble diagnosis for power supply circuit.
NO >> Repair or replace error-detected parts.
3.CHECK FPCM GROUND CIRCUIT
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Check the continuity between FPCM harness connector and ground.
3. Also check harness for short to power.
Is the inspection result normal? YES >> GO TO 4.
NO >> Repair or replace error-detected parts.
4.CHECK FPCM INPUT AND OUTPUT CIRCUITS
1. Disconnect ECM harness connector.
2. Check the continuity between FPCM harness connector and ECM harness connector
3. Also check harness for short to ground and to power.
Is the inspection result normal? YES >> GO TO 5.
NO >> Repair or replace error-detected parts.
5.CHECK FUEL PUMP CONTROL CIRCUIT
1. Disconnect fuel level sensor unit (fuel pump) harness connector.
2. Check the continuity between FPCM harness connector and fuel level sensor unit (fuel pump) harness connector.
3. Also check harness for short to ground and to power.
Is the inspection result normal? YES >> GO TO 6.
NO >> Repair or replace error-detected parts.
6.CHECK FPCM
Check the FPCM. Refer to EC-325, "Component Inspection (FPCM)".
Is the inspection result normal? YES >> Check intermittent incident .Refer to GI-42, "Intermittent Incident".
NO >> Replace FPCM. Refer to EC-448, "Removal and Installation".
